Costa Rica
Costa Rica, officially known as the Republic of Costa Rica, is a country located in Central America. It is bordered by Nicaragua to the north, Panama to the southeast, the Pacific Ocean to the west, and the Caribbean Sea to the east.
Covering an area of approximately 51,100 square kilometers, Costa Rica is home to a population of over 5 million people. The capital and largest city is San José.
Costa Rica is known for its rich biodiversity, boasting abundant plant and animal species. The country is a popular ecotourism destination, with numerous national parks, rainforests, and protected areas. It is also recognized for its commitment to environmental sustainability, being one of the few countries in the world to have abolished its military.
In addition to its natural beauty, Costa Rica has a stable democratic government and a relatively high standard of living compared to other countries in the region. Its economy is based on agriculture, tourism, and technology, with a focus on renewable energy sources.
Costa Rica has a strong cultural heritage, influenced by its indigenous roots as well as Spanish colonial history. The official language is Spanish, and Christianity is the predominant religion.
